Just Call Me Jezzel Fixit

Here's the first test of my DIY spray bar attachment I made for my Eheim ECCO 2232. Its just an 8" length of 1/2" PVC with an end cap. Nothing is silconed together it just fits tightly on its own. I had to sand the edges of the pvc to make it fit on the tubing correctly but all in all this cost me $1.50 and took maybe 3 minutes to make with a power drill and some sand paper.

The holes need to be widen a bit because the flow is too strong at this size. The filter and spray bar are going on my 55g planted tank as soon as it comes out of dry start in about 4 weeks.
